[Reporter Ge Youhao/Kaohsiung Report] The fourth briefing session in Dalin Puqian Village, Kaohsiung will be held on February 11. The Kaohsiung Municipal Government emphasized that it will communicate with sincerity and help residents rejoice in their new homes.

After Kaohsiung Mayor Chen Chi-mai took office on August 24, 2019, he communicated with the residents of Dalinpu, and visited the local village head and local people many times to discuss the direction of relocating the village.

After the draft of the village relocation plan was made public in February 2010, three village relocation explanatory meetings have been held successively. Chen Qimai attended all of them in person and communicated directly with the residents face to face. House".

The Gaocheng Metropolitan Development Bureau emphasized that in order to take into account the property rights, living rights and social rights of Dalinpu residents, the content of the village relocation draft includes that 1 ping of land in the private residential and commercial area of ​​Dalinpu can be exchanged for 1 ping to the resettlement site for the village, and the non-residential and commercial land will be charged at the market price 40% compensation, compensation for new reconstruction price of buildings and other favorable conditions.

In response to the opinions reflected by the residents in the first three briefing sessions, the Gao City Hall and the Ministry of Economic Affairs have discussed and participated in the discussion, including relaxing the qualification for exchanging 1 ping for 1 ping of land in private residential and commercial areas, increasing the income loss allowance for agricultural products, and increasing market stalls Relief, increasing relocation fees for disadvantaged households, increasing the volume of resettlement land, increasing the land in agricultural areas, expropriating across districts and replacing land in residential areas in Gaoping specific areas, etc.

Wu Wenyan, head of the Metropolitan Development Bureau of Gaoshi City, pointed out that the funds for the relocation of the village have been supported by the Executive Yuan, which has been increased from the original 58.981 billion yuan to 69.431 billion yuan, hoping to reflect the justice of living and take care of every Dalinpu resident.

Wu Wenyan said that for the planning of the resettlement site for the village relocation, a road of more than 10 meters is planned for each street. The land selected by the residents is a square base and adjacent to the environment of the main road, and the public facilities of the resettlement site will be supplemented, including New schools, community parks, activity centers, fire brigades, police stations, markets, etc. will be built.

In terms of transportation, the nearby National 1 and Taiwan 88, together with the upcoming MRT Yellow Line, will also increase the convenience of residents' transportation.
